Deer Rut Season

Deer rut season typically runs from October through early January. It's important to be extra cautious on area roadways this time of year, as deer may experience behavioral changes and could quickly dart into oncoming traffic. It's also important to stay clear of the deer population and avoid approaching them if they are nearby.

Also, as a friendly reminder, the feeding of deer is prohibited in the City of Lakeway. Deer corn and other food provided by humans can be an unhealthy alternative to their normal diet. It also causes deer to congregate more in populated areas, leading to the potential for damage on area properties and a hazard for drivers in the area.
